Standalone builds crash on launch in Facebook GameRoom at physx::shdfnd::Foundation::getTempAllocFreeTable
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open attached project
Alternatively - create a new project and import Facebook SDK package
2. Build Windows standalone
3. Open Facebook GameRoom
4. Click on your profile (top left) and select [DEV] Debug Unity
5. Select Windows Standalone .exe
Result: game crashes before launching, Facebook GameRoom throws "Sorry, something went wrong."
Reproducible with: 5.5.0b3, 5.5.0p1
Not reproducible with: 5.4.3p3, 5.5.0b2
Regression introduced in 5.5.0b3
